Webb20 mars 2024 · Phillis Wheatley Peters, also spelled Phyllis and Wheatly (c. 1753 – December 5, 1784) was an American author who is considered the first African-American author of a published book of poetry. Born in West Africa, she was sold into slavery at the age of seven or eight and transported to North America, where she was bought by the … Webb4 aug. 2024 · Phillis Wheatley was born in an unknown location around Senegal or Gambia around 1753. After being kidnapped at age 6 and sold to slavery in America, she fought against slavery and managed to become America's first published African-American woman.
